MEMORY TAPES: 24TH DECEMBER 2010
The Memory Tapes today is back to the theme of musical educations. Michelle Wilby writes...
"I created a memory tape (or CD) for my nephew, Niall, who is going to be one on 22nd December. I live quite a way from my nephew so unfortunately I can't be around him alot to introduce him to good music and I can't rely on my brother to educate him correctly!
"So I have decided to create a CD for him for his birthday each year so that he will have a collection of decent music to listen to as he grows up! This is my first one and has been complied based on bands/musicans that I have seen during the year as well as memories of drunken nights out such as stumbling round London on a David Bowie tour or jumping round like an idiot at a Pixies night at Feeling Gloomy in Islington and finally listening to my mate at work trying to do impressions of Morrissey!"
And here are the tracks:
1. The Mail and Misery - Broken Bells
2. White Riot - The Clash
3. We Share The Same Skies - Cribs
4. Oh You Pretty Things - David Bowie
5. Counterpoint - Delphic
6. Me and The Moon - The Drums
7. Spanish Sahara - Foals
8. On Melancholy Hill - Gorillaz
9. I Still Do - I Am Kloot
10. Lisztomania - Phoenix
11. Gigantic - Pixies
12. Don't fight it, feel it - Primal Scream
13. Chasing Rainbows - Shed Seven
14. There Is A Light That Never Goes Out - The Smiths
15. Sweet Disposition - The Temper Trap
16. Come Back Home - Two Door Cinema Club
17. Always Like This - Bombay Bicycle Club
18. Dancing In The Dark - Bruce Springsteen
19. Superstition - Stevie Wonder.
